Compare Bridges Financial Services vs sogotrade Commission And Fees
Bridges Financial Services and sogotrade are online brokerage platforms, and most online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The reason for this is that the companies of online trading platforms are scaled much better. In other words, an internet broker isn't necessarily influenced by the amount of customers they have.
But this doesn't nec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ge prices of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are primarily three types of penalties for this objective.
The first kind of charges to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make an actual tr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ading fees. In such instances, you are spending a spread, funding rate, or even a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the prices vary from broker to broker.
Commissions can be fixed or determined by the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read denotes the difference between the buying and selling cost. Financing or overnight rates are people that are billed when you hold a leveraged position for longer than daily.
Apart from trading charges, online brokers also bill non-trading fees. These are dependent on the activities you undertake on your accounts. They're billed for operations like depositing money, not investing for lengthy periods, or withdrawals.
